#clr { clear:both;}.bg_main { background: url(../images/bg.gif); padding: 0; margin: 
0px 0px 15px 0px; text-align: center; vertical-align: top;}#main_container { padding	
: 0; margin:0px auto; text-align : center;}/* *********************************** 
header */#header { width:760px; height:55px; margin:0px auto; text-align:left;	
padding:4px 0px 0px 0px; border:0;}/* ******************************************* 
topnavi*/#topnavi { background: url(../images/bg_topnavi.gif) repeat-x; width:100%;	
height:41px; margin:0px; padding:2px; text-align:center; border:0;}#topnavi a.topnavi:link, 
a.topnavi:visited { font-family: Verdana,Tahoma,Arial; font-size: 10px; font-weight: 
bold; letter-spacing : 1px; color: #FFFFFF; padding-left: 17px; padding-right: 
7px; line-height:35px;}#topnavi a.topnavi:hover { color: #FF6600; border-bottom: 
none; line-height:35px;}#topnavi a.topnavi:active { color: #FF6600; border-bottom: 
none; line-height:35px;}/* ******************************************* pathway 
and SEARCH and xline*/#xline_out { margin : 8px 0; padding : 0; width : 736px 
!important; height : 20px;}#xline { float : left; background : url(../images/xline.gif);	
left : 0px; margin : 0; padding : 0; width : 616px !important; height : 20px;}#can_pathway 
{ margin : 0px auto; padding : 0; width : 760px !important; height : 25px; text-align	
: left; text-indent : 12px; font-weight: bold; color : #000000; line-height : 
20px;}#can_pathway img { margin:14px 1px 1px 1px;}.pathway { padding : 0px; margin	
: 0px 0px 0px 0px; border : 0; line-height : 25px;}a.pathway:link, a.pathway:visited 
{ color : #C1252C; font-size : 12px; font-weight : bold; line-height : 22px;}a.pathway:hover 
{ color : #000000; font-size : 12px; font-weight : bold;}#search { float : right;	
margin:0px; padding : 0px; left : 642px; background-color: #E9DAB2; width : 114px 
!important; height : 20px !important; text-indent : 12px; text-align : center;	
font-family : Verdana, Helvetica, sans-serif; line-height : 19px;}.searchbox {	
font : normal 10px Verdana, Arial, Helvetica, sans-serif; color : #000000; border 
: 1px; background-color: #F6F4B8;}/* ******************************************* 
flashnews and flash */#header2 { padding : 0; margin : 0; width : 736px; height	
: 154px; text-align : left;}#flash { float : left; padding : 0; margin : 0; left	
: 0px; border : 2px solid #CAC808; width : 252px; height : 154px; text-align : 
center;}#newsflasharea { float : right; left : 262px; margin : 0; padding : 0; 
width : 474px; height : 154px; text-align : left; overflow : hidden;}#newsflash 
{ margin : 0; padding : 0; width : 470px; height : 92px; text-align : left; overflow	
: auto;}#banner { margin : 0; padding : 0; width : 100%; height : 62px; text-align	
: left;}#newsflash table.moduletable { padding : 0px; margin : 0px 0px 0px 0px;	
border : 0;}#newsflash table.moduletable th { background : transparent; margin	
: 0; padding : 0; height:18px; font : bold 10px Verdana, Arial, Helvetica, sans-serif;	
color : #000000; line-height : 15px; text-align : left; text-indent :0px;}#newsflash 
table.moduletable td { font-family : verdana, Arial, Helvetica, sans-serif; font-size	
: 11px; color : #CEBA7B; line-height : 16px; text-align : left; padding:0px;}#blocks 
{ width : 100%; margin : 0px 0px 0px 0px; text-align : left;}#blocks table.moduletable 
th { background-color: transparent; height:21px; border-bottom:2px solid #CAC808;	
font : bold 11px Verdana, sans-serif, Helvetica ; color: #000000; text-align: 
left; text-indent: 4px; padding: 0px; margin: 0px; line-height:19px;}#blocks table.moduletable 
td { font-family : Verdana, Helvetica, sans-serif; font-size : 11px; color : #5C5649;	
line-height : 16px; text-align : left; padding:0p 2px 4px 2px;}#blocks .moduletable 
a:link, #blocks .moduletable a:visited { font-family : Arial, Verdana, Helvetica, 
sans-serif; font-size : 11px; color : #C17327; text-decoration : none; line-height:17px;	
font-weight:bolder;}#blocks .moduletable a:hover { font-size : 10px; color : #D0965D; 
text-decoration : underline;}#botnavi table.moduletable { width : 100%; padding	
: 0px; margin : 0px 0px 0px 0px; border : 0;}/* ******************************************* 
leftside and rightside*/#leftside { margin : 0px 5px 0px 0px; padding:0; text-align: 
left;}#leftside table.moduletable th { background-color: transparent; height:21px;	
border-bottom:2px solid #CAC808; font : bold 11px Verdana, sans-serif, Helvetica 
; color: #000000; text-align: left; text-indent: 4px; padding: 0px; margin: 0px; 
line-height:19px;}#leftside table.moduletable td { font-family : verdana, Arial, 
Helvetica, sans-serif; font-size : 11px; color: #000000; line-height : 16px; text-align 
: left; padding : 2px 0px 2px 0px;}/* ******************************************* 
main body */#content_area { left : 0px; margin : 0px; padding : 0; text-align	
: left;}#rightside { margin : 0px 0px 0px 5px; padding : 0; text-align : left;}#rightside 
table.moduletable th { background-color: transparent; height:21px; border-bottom:2px 
solid #CAC808; font : bold 11px Verdana, sans-serif, Helvetica ; color: #000000;	
text-align: left; text-indent: 4px; padding: 0px; margin: 0px; line-height:19px;}#rightside 
table.moduletable td { font-family : verdana,Arial, Helvetica, sans-serif; font-size	
: 10px; color: #000000; line-height : 16px; text-align : left;}/* ******************************************* 
Footer */#footer { padding : 6px 20px 0px 0px; margin : 0px auto; width : 760px;	
text-align : right; vertical-align : middle; font : bold 10px Verdana, Arial, 
Helvetica, sans-serif; color : #F9F9DC; line-height : 15px;}#footer a, #footer 
a:link, #footer a:visited { color : #C33C12; text-decoration :underline;}#footer 
a, #footer a:hover { color :#000000; text-decoration :none;}/* ******************************************* 
General CSS Styles */body { background : #ffffff; padding : 0; margin : 0; vertical-align	
: top; scrollbar-face-color: #CEBA7B; scrollbar-shadow-color: #FAFADC; scrollbar-darkshadow-color: 
#F6F595; scrollbar-highlight-color: #F6F595; scrollbar-3dlight-color: #FAFADC; 
scrollbar-track-color: #FAFADC; scrollbar-arrow-color: #FAFADC;}td, div, p { color:#000000;	
font-family : Verdana, sans-serif, Helvetica ; font-size : 12px; line-height : 
16px;}a, a:link, a:visited { color : #000000; font-family : Verdana, sans-serif, 
Helvetica ; font-size : 12px; font-weight : bold; text-decoration : none;}a:hover 
{color: #C22E14;font-size:12px;font-weight: bold; text-decoration:none}h1 {font: 
bold 16px Georgia, "Times New Roman", Times, serif; color: #333; margin: 0px; 
padding: 0px;}h2 {font: bold 15px Georgia, "Times New Roman", Times, serif; color: 
#333; margin: 0px; padding: 0px;}h3 {font: bold 14px Georgia, "Times New Roman", 
Times, serif; color: #333; margin: 0px; padding: 0px;}h4 {font: bold 12px Georgia, 
"Times New Roman", Times, serif; color: #333; margin: 0px; padding: 0px;}ol {list-style: 
decimal outside; }ul { margin: 0; padding: 0; list-style: none;}li { line-height: 
17px; text-indent: 13px; padding-top: 0px; background : url(../images/bg_title.gif) 
no-repeat; background-position: 0px 5px;}blockquote { margin : 10px; margin-left	
: 30px; padding : 0 20px 0 10px; border-left : 5px solid #ccc;}form { margin : 
0; padding : 0;}select { font-size : 12px; font-weight : bold; color : #333;}input 
{ padding : 0; margin : 0;}th.pagenav_prev, th.pagenav_next, a.pagenav_next:link, 
a.pagenav_next:visited { font-size : 10px; color : #ffffff; background-color:#FFFFFF;	
font-weight : normal;}a.pagenav_next:hover { font-size : 12px; color : #2A95FA; 
text-decoration : none;}/* ******************************************* MODULES 
*/table.moduletable { width : 100%; padding : 0px; margin : 0px 0px 0px 0px; border	
: 0;}table.moduletable th { background-color: transparent; height:21px; border-bottom:2px 
solid #CAC808; font : bold 11px Arial, Verdana, sans-serif, Helvetica ; color: 
#000000; text-align: left; text-indent: 4px; padding: 0px; margin: 0px; line-height:19px;}table.moduletable 
td { font-family : Arial, Helvetica, sans-serif; font-size : 11px; color: #C4C35F;	
line-height : 16px; text-align : left;}table.pollstableborder td { padding: 2px;}table.moduletable 
ul { padding : 0; margin : 0 0 0 3px;}.button { font : bold 12px verdana, Arial, 
Helvetica, sans-serif; padding-top : 2px 2px 0px 2px; margin:3px 0; color : #F6F4B8; 
border : 0px; background-color: #000000;}.inputbox, .search { font : bold 10px 
verdana, Helvetica, sans-serif; color : #000000; border : 2px solid #CAC808; background-color: 
#ffffff;}.poll { font : 12px Arial, Helvetica, sans-serif; color : #F3FACE; font-weight 
: normal; border : 0; padding : 0;}/* ******************************************* 
CONTENT STYLES */.contentpane, .contentpaneopen { width : 100%; text-align : left; 
color : #000000; padding : 0px;}.contentdescription { width : 100%; text-align 
: left; color : #000000; padding : 4px;}.contentpane td, .contentpaneopen td { 
padding : 0px; }a.contentpane:link, a.contentpane:visited, a.contentpaneopen:link, 
a.contentpaneopen:visited { color : #C17327; text-decoration : none}a.contentpane:hover, 
a.contentpaneopen:hover { color : #2A95FA; text-decoration : underline;}.contentheading 
{ width:100%; font : bold 12px Verdana, Arial, Helvetica, sans-serif; color : 
#F9F9D7; line-height : 21px; text-align : left; text-indent : 5px; background-color:#000000;}.componentheading 
{ width:100%; font : bold 12px Verdana, Arial, Helvetica, sans-serif; color : 
#000000; line-height : 21px; text-align : left; text-indent : 5px; background-color: 
transparent; border-bottom:2px solid #CAC808;}.contentpagetitle, a.contentpagetitle:link, 
a.contentpagetitle:visited { color : #234;}a.contentpagetitle:hover { color : 
#567;}.back_button { float:right; width:45px; font-size : 12px; color : #000000; 
text-decoration : none; font-weight : normal; test-align:right; vertical-align 
: middle; margin : 0 6px; padding : 1px 4px 1px 4px; background-color:#ffffff; 
border:0px;}.small { font-size : 10px; color : #C22E14; text-decoration : none; 
font-weight : bold; line-height:15px;}.createdate, .modifydate { font-size : 10px; 
font-weight : normal; color : #C22E14;}a.readon:link, a.readon:visited { font-family 
: Verdana, Helvetica,sans-serif; font-size : 10px; font-weight : bold; color : 
#000000;}a.readon:hover { color : #C22E14; font-size : 12px; text-decoration : 
bold; }.blog { margin : 0px; padding : 0px; width :100%;}a.blogsection:link, a.blogsection:visited 
{ font: bold 10px Verdana, Arial, Helvetica, sans-serif; color : #000000; text-decoration 
: none; font-weight : normal; font-weight : bolder;}a.blogsection:hover { font: 
bold 10px Verdana, Arial, Helvetica, sans-serif; font-size : 11px; color : #C22E14; 
text-decoration : normal; font-weight : bolder;}.blog_more { padding : 18px 8px; 
margin : 0px; font-size : 14px; font-weight : bold; color : #333;}.blog_more ul 
{ padding : 0px; margin : 0px;}table.contenttoc { border : 1px solid #DEC298; 
padding : 1px; margin-left : 7px; margin-bottom : 2px;}table.contenttoc th { color 
: #fff; text-align : left; padding : 4px; font-weight : bold; font-size : 10px; 
text-transform : uppercase; background : #DEC298;}table.contenttoc td { font-size 
: 10px;}/* ******************************************* STYLES CONTACT PAGE */table.contact 
{ background : transparent;}table.contact td.icons { background : #89a;}table.contact 
td.details { background : #FAFADC; margin : 5px; padding : 5px; border : 1px dotted 
#ccc;}.contact_email { background : #FAFADC; margin : 5px; padding : 5px; border 
: 1px dotted #ccc;}/* ******************************************* MAIN AND SUB 
MENU SYSTEM */.mainlevel { font: bold 12px Verdana, Helvetica, sans-serif; line-height:20px;}a.mainlevel:link, 
a.mainlevel:visited { display: block; background: url(../images/bg_submenu.gif) 
no-repeat; background-position: 0px 0px; padding: 0; border-bottom:2px solid #CAC808; 
height:20px; line-height:20px; color: #000000; font: bold 11px Verdana, Helvetica, 
sans-serif; text-decoration: none; text-indent: 15px;}a.mainlevel:hover { font-weight: 
bold; color: #B8B607; background: url(../images/bg_submenu.gif) no-repeat; text-decoration 
: none; padding: 0px 0px; text-align:center;}.sublevel { width:94%; color: #FFA554; 
padding : 0px 0px; text-indent: 5px; border: 0; height:18px; line-height:20px; 
text-decoration : none;}a.sublevel:link, a.sublevel:visited { color: #FFA554; 
text-decoration:none;}a.sublevel:hover { color: #FF6600; text-decoration:none;}a.sublevel#active_menu 
{ background: url(../images/indent1.png) no-repeat; border: 0; color : #FF6600;	
text-decoration : none;}/* ******************************************* TOP MENU 
SYSTEM */ul#mainlevel-nav { font: bold 10px Verdana, Arial, Helvetica, sans-serif;	
list-style : none; padding : 0; margin : 0;}ul#mainlevel-nav li{ display : block;	
background : transparent; padding : 0; margin : 0; float : left; white-space : 
nowrap; border-right: 2px solid #F6EAC7;}ul#mainlevel-nav li a { display : block;	
height : 14px !important; height : 17px; padding : 1px 1px 1px 4px; margin : 0;	
width : 75px !important; width : 80px; text-decoration : none; color : #BF7300;	
background : #FFF5E5;}ul#mainlevel-nav li a:hover{ color: #BF7300; background: 
#DEC298;}a.mainlevel-nav:link, a.mainlevel-nav:visited { color : #7B7261;}a.mainlevel-nav:hover 
{ color : #5E776B;}/* ******************************************* CATEGORY (text 
format and links) */.category { color : #5A3600; font-size : 11px; font-weight	
: bold; text-decoration : none; }a.category:link, a.category:visited { color : 
#C22E14; font-weight : bold;}a.category:hover { color : #CAC808;} /* ******************************************* 
STYLES LISTING CONTENT PAGE */td.sectiontableheader, td.sectiontablefooter { background-color: 
#000000; color : #FAFADC; font-weight : bold; font-size : 11px; padding : 2px 
3px 3px 2px;}.sectiontableentry1 { background-color: #FAFADC; color : #000000; 
font-weight : normal; padding : 2px 0px 2px 2px;}.sectiontableentry2 { background 
: #ffffff; color : #000000; font-weight : normal; padding : 2px 0px 2px 2px;}.pagenavbar 
{ text-align : center; vertical-align : middle; padding : 2px; width : 100%;}.pagenav 
{ color : #ffffff; font-size : 10px; font-weight : bold; text-decoration : none;	
marging : 0; padding : 0 2px; border : 0;}a.pagenav:link, a.pagenav:visited {	
color : #ffffff; background-color: transparent;}a.pagenav:hover { color : #000000; 
background : transparent; text-decoration : underline;}hr { background : transparent; 
height : 1px; border : 1px solid #DEC298; width : 100%;}